What causes dry mouth (xerostomia)?
Dry mouth is most commonly caused by medications (antidepressants, antihistamines, blood pressure drugs — over 400 medications list dry mouth as a side effect), radiation therapy to the head and neck (which damages salivary glands), autoimmune conditions (Sjögren's syndrome), diabetes, ageing, mouth breathing, and anxiety. It significantly affects quality of life and oral health.
Why is insufficient saliva a problem for oral health?
Saliva is not just moisture — it contains enzymes, antibodies, and minerals that protect teeth from decay, neutralise acids, and maintain the oral microbiome. Without adequate saliva, tooth decay accelerates dramatically, gum disease risk increases, oral thrush is more common, and eating and speaking become uncomfortable.
